The 2011 Channel One Cup was played between 15–18 December 2011, during the 2011 European Trophy playoffs. The Czech Republic, Finland, Sweden and Russia played a round-robin for a total of three games per team and six games in total. Five of the matches were played in the Megasport Arena in Moscow, Russia, and one match in the ČEZ Stadion Chomutov in Chomutov, Czech Republic. Sweden won the tournament, which was part of Euro Hockey Tour 2011–12.

Tournament awards

Best players selected by the directorate:

  • Best Goaltender: Viktor Fasth
  • Best Defenceman: Staffan Kronwall
  • Best Forward: Alexander Radulov
  • Top Scorer: Staffan Kronwall (3 goals, 1 assist)
  • Most Valuable Player: Zbyněk Irgl
